Tree community structure data of arid riparian forests in the Ulungur River Basin

This dataset contains quadrat-level tree community structure and environmental data collected from arid riparian forests in the Ulungur River Basin, northwestern China. The data were obtained from field surveys conducted across 22 sampling sites, with each site including approximately four 30 m × 30 m quadrats (a small number of sites include two to three quadrats due to field constraints). For each quadrat, tree community structure was quantified using a set of stand-level structural indicators, including maximum and mean diameter at breast height, maximum and mean tree height, alive ratio, and mean health score. In addition, key environmental variables describing local habitat conditions were measured, including elevation, slope, and stand density. The dataset was used to investigate the relative contributions of environmental filtering and density dependence to variation in tree community structure at the quadrat scale. Specifically, the data support variance partitioning and redundancy analysis (RDA) to disentangle the independent and shared effects of topographic factors and stand density on forest stand structure in arid river valley ecosystems. All variables are provided in a single Excel file (Tree community structure data.xlsx). Two accompanying R scripts (Variance partitioning analysis R code.txt and RDA analysis R code.txt) reproduce the main statistical analyses reported in the associated manuscript. This dataset is intended to support transparency, reproducibility, and future comparative studies of riparian forest structure and ecological processes in arid environments.
